Analysis
The most recent figure for beneficiary incidence in 4th quintile (%) - all social assistance in Panama is 16.5%, measured in 2023.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 12.2% on the previous year and up 19.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, beneficiary incidence in 4th quintile (%) - all social assistance in Panama peaked at 18.8% in 2021 and was at its lowest, 12.6%, in 2008.
Panama ranks 18th of 39 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 14 years of available data.

About this data
Percentage of program beneficiaries in a quintile relative to the total number of beneficiaries in the population
